About Pioneer Millworks
Pioneer Millworks manufactures and sells sustainable and reclaimed wood products, including flooring, paneling, siding, and related materials. We serve architects, interior designers, builders, developers, homeowners, and select commercial and hospitality audiences.
Our brand is built on craftsmanship, sustainability with proof, expertise in reclaimed and sustainable wood, American manufacturing, employee ownership, and the belief that materials should have both substance and story. We aim to be a thoughtful, premium, values-driven material partner.
